摘要
A chromaticity approach for the inspection of passive films on 304 stainless steel is explored by measuring the redness degree of the colouration reaction product of phenanthroline. The measurement exhibits good capability in evaluating film quality. The,measured values are dependent on the structural integrity of the passive films. Based on the electrochemical examination and XPS spectra, this approach is discussed from the view point of the inhibition of the passive films on the release of ferrous from the matrix during its reaction with phenanthroline. The preferential dissolution of Fe-rich oxides in the films can affect the measurement. (C) 2013 Elsevier Ltd. All rights reserved.
